STC89C52单片机能进行掉电保存吗?
STC89C52单片机可以用EEPROM进行掉电保存,当需要保存的数据变化时,写EEPROM保存一次,下次开机从EEPROM读出来就行了。
完全可以,参数可以随时调整,随时存储,不过每次调整一下都要按存储键才能存储。本人用的就是89C52和90C52两种单片机。参数可以随时调整,随时存储,不过每次调整一下都要按存储键才能存储。
STC89C52单片机可以掉电保存程序,可以不用电池保存N多年。如果想修改程序里面的一些初始化数据,原来的全部程序就都必须重写。
STC系列单片机大多数型号有一个低电压检测中断功能,可以在这个中断***进行保存需要保存的数据,待下次上电时恢复保存的数据就可以了,STC89C52单片机可以外接一个电压检测电路连接一个INT中断也可以做到。
STC89C52单片机掉电保存很容易的,利用内部的EEPROM就可以保存,每当需要保存的数据变化时,就写一次EEPROM保存,开机时再读出保存的数据就行了。见下表。
STC89C52单片机如何在运行时向EEPROM内写入数据,使数据断电后不消失...
单片机有程序存储区和数据存储区,在写程序时,将数据存放在程序存储区(ROM区)即可使断电时,数据不丢失。
需要***外电路触发,即***在断电时***给一个触发***信号***产生一个中断,如***5***V***单片机***在***5***V***时产生***触发中断***就可以。中断服务程序***完成***把需要保存的数据***写入***EEPROM***中。上电时读出恢复。
STC89C52单片机掉电保存很容易的,利用内部的EEPROM就可以保存,每当需要保存的数据变化时,就写一次EEPROM保存,开机时再读出保存的数据就行了。见下表。
STC89C52单片机可以掉电保存程序,可以不用电池保存N多年。如果想修改程序里面的一些初始化数据,原来的全部程序就都必须重写。
单片机内部eeprom难,还是做PC端保存数据难?
EEPROM则更多的用作非易失的数据存储器。
如果你会使用AVR单片机,那就更好了,比如Atmega128单片机内部有128K的ROM,在对这种单片机编程时只需要和AT89S52一样的下载线即可,不需要编程器(W78E516B需要编程器的)。
EEPROM******为电擦除的******不用插拔******可以在线擦除******能够多次反复使用******可烧写次数一般达***到1万***次以上***但擦写速度要比RAM读写存储器要慢好几个数量级。
往单片机的Flash里存数据一般有特殊的编程步骤,各种单片机都不一样,也要查看数据手册。单片机没有Flash的话,就需要扩展存储器了。EPROM是紫外线擦除的,不能用。EEPROM是电擦除的。
EEPROM是掉电也不丢数据的存储器,一般都用来存设置的。你可以一字节一字节的把每字节的8位1任意编写成0。但这片一般是按扇区为单位,一擦除就是全成1。STC有的片FLASH也能在跑程序的时候由程序控制擦写。
STC89C52单片机掉电保存如何实现?
1、STC系列单片机大多数型号有一个低电压检测中断功能,可以在这个中断***进行保存需要保存的数据,待下次上电时恢复保存的数据就可以了,STC89C52单片机可以外接一个电压检测电路连接一个INT中断也可以做到。
2、STC89C52单片机可以用EEPROM进行掉电保存,当需要保存的数据变化时,写EEPROM保存一次,下次开机从EEPROM读出来就行了。
3、单片机有程序存储区和数据存储区,在写程序时,将数据存放在程序存储区(ROM区)即可使断电时,数据不丢失。
4、需要***外电路触发,即***在断电时***给一个触发***信号***产生一个中断,如***5***V***单片机***在***5***V***时产生***触发中断***就可以。中断服务程序***完成***把需要保存的数据***写入***EEPROM***中。上电时读出恢复。
5、擦除EEROM某个扇区,比如第1个扇区(地址2000h~21FFh),再对扇区写入数据,上电再读取就好了。
eeprom怎么与单片机连接
1、用软件里有一个设置按钮,单开以后把h文件点上就Ok了。
2、首先打开电脑中的keil软件。在页面中点击“工程”新建一个工程,命名为“点亮LED”,点击确定。出现一个选择芯片型号的对话框,选择Atmel里面的“89C52”,点击确定进行下一步。
3、根据你这个图,2732的OE是接在单片机的PSEN上的,那这个存储器就属于程序存储器,要用***MOVC***A***,***@A+DPTR。
4、单片机自身一般只是带一种程序存储器,或者是EEPROM,或者是FLASH。无论带的什么类型的程序存储器,都是来保存程序的。“下载”的时候,把程序代码写入程序存储器;“运行”的时候,CPU从程序存储器取出代码来执行。
5、以下是我曾经做过的东东中的有关EEPROM读写的一段程序,供参考。
6、应该是单片机用于控制外部数据存储器的主要引脚有两个,即是控制信号RD和WR,RD为读信号,接到存储器的OE端,WR为写信号,接到存储器的WE端。其实应该叫三组总线:地址总线、数据总线和控制总线,RD和WR为控制总线。
本文转载自互联网,如有侵权,联系删除